aws / karpenter-provider-aws

Karpenter is a Kubernetes Node Autoscaler built for flexibility, performance, and simplicity.
https://karpenter.sh
Apache License 2.0
6.15k stars 849 forks source link

feat: Add kubelet configuration to EC2NodeClass V1 API #6418

Closed engedaam closed 4 days ago

engedaam commented 6 days ago

Fixes #N/A

Description

How was this change tested?

Does this change impact docs?

By submitting this pull request, I confirm that my contribution is made under the terms of the Apache 2.0 license.

netlify[bot] commented 6 days ago

Deploy Preview for karpenter-docs-prod canceled.

Name Link
Latest commit da686a1450a9816f105dc78edd30e4277575fa93
Latest deploy log https://app.netlify.com/sites/karpenter-docs-prod/deploys/667dec956dcd21000854a53c
coveralls commented 6 days ago

Pull Request Test Coverage Report for Build 9691641086

Details


Changes Missing Coverage Covered Lines Changed/Added Lines %
pkg/apis/v1/zz_generated.deepcopy.go 1 79 1.27%
<!-- Total: 1 79 1.27% -->
Totals Coverage Status
Change from base Build 9691055348: -0.8%
Covered Lines: 5787
Relevant Lines: 7394

💛 - Coveralls
coveralls commented 5 days ago

Pull Request Test Coverage Report for Build 9691723908

Warning: This coverage report may be inaccurate.

This pull request's base commit is no longer the HEAD commit of its target branch. This means it includes changes from outside the original pull request, including, potentially, unrelated coverage changes.

Details


Changes Missing Coverage Covered Lines Changed/Added Lines %
pkg/apis/v1/zz_generated.deepcopy.go 1 79 1.27%
<!-- Total: 1 79 1.27% -->
Totals Coverage Status
Change from base Build 9691055348: -0.8%
Covered Lines: 5787
Relevant Lines: 7394

💛 - Coveralls
coveralls commented 5 days ago

Pull Request Test Coverage Report for Build 9691801176

Details


Changes Missing Coverage Covered Lines Changed/Added Lines %
pkg/apis/v1/zz_generated.deepcopy.go 1 79 1.27%
<!-- Total: 1 79 1.27% -->
Files with Coverage Reduction New Missed Lines %
pkg/providers/amifamily/ami.go 1 90.56%
<!-- Total: 1 -->
Totals Coverage Status
Change from base Build 9691760501: -0.8%
Covered Lines: 5787
Relevant Lines: 7394

💛 - Coveralls
coveralls commented 5 days ago

Pull Request Test Coverage Report for Build 9692014160

Details


Changes Missing Coverage Covered Lines Changed/Added Lines %
pkg/apis/v1/zz_generated.deepcopy.go 1 79 1.27%
<!-- Total: 1 79 1.27% -->
Files with Coverage Reduction New Missed Lines %
pkg/providers/amifamily/ami.go 1 90.56%
<!-- Total: 1 -->
Totals Coverage Status
Change from base Build 9691760501: -0.8%
Covered Lines: 5787
Relevant Lines: 7394

💛 - Coveralls
coveralls commented 5 days ago

Pull Request Test Coverage Report for Build 9692036061

Details


Changes Missing Coverage Covered Lines Changed/Added Lines %
pkg/apis/v1/zz_generated.deepcopy.go 1 79 1.27%
<!-- Total: 1 79 1.27% -->
Files with Coverage Reduction New Missed Lines %
pkg/providers/amifamily/ami.go 1 90.56%
<!-- Total: 1 -->
Totals Coverage Status
Change from base Build 9691760501: -0.8%
Covered Lines: 5787
Relevant Lines: 7394

💛 - Coveralls
engedaam commented 5 days ago

What do you mean? What is only available on 1.25+?

coveralls commented 5 days ago

Pull Request Test Coverage Report for Build 9704575948

Details


Changes Missing Coverage Covered Lines Changed/Added Lines %
pkg/apis/v1/zz_generated.deepcopy.go 1 79 1.27%
<!-- Total: 1 79 1.27% -->
Totals Coverage Status
Change from base Build 9704271327: -0.8%
Covered Lines: 5785
Relevant Lines: 7386

💛 - Coveralls
coveralls commented 5 days ago

Pull Request Test Coverage Report for Build 9704641128

Warning: This coverage report may be inaccurate.

This pull request's base commit is no longer the HEAD commit of its target branch. This means it includes changes from outside the original pull request, including, potentially, unrelated coverage changes.

Details


Changes Missing Coverage Covered Lines Changed/Added Lines %
pkg/apis/v1/zz_generated.deepcopy.go 1 79 1.27%
<!-- Total: 1 79 1.27% -->
Totals Coverage Status
Change from base Build 9704271327: -0.8%
Covered Lines: 5786
Relevant Lines: 7386

💛 - Coveralls